I think there is quite noticeable difference between G9P and G9N screens where G9N's have almost perfect uniformity but they are a little warmer while G9P's are cooler but uniformity is utter crap. We got 2 new 12 Pro's and one was with N and other with P screen and that P is really horrible in terms of uniformity but N is perfect. I tried to order new one and it also came with P screen that is even worse. But both P-screens are pretty cool, so I guess those who hate warm yellowish screen like them. I'm not just sure if anyone preferring those cooler one have really checked uniformity well enough?
Also anyone got 12 Pro with rear camera serial number starting with G (instead of usual D)?
First two we got were both with rear camera serial starting with D and they seemed equally good but last one came with G serial camera and it is totally different in terms of photo quality and can be easily seen side by side with D serial camera.
Just wondering if those G serial cameras are from some third party vendor with different specs to fill up the void for parts in current situation...?
Please check that with 3u Tools what rear camera serial is in your 12 Pro?
It is listed on the same page where you find OLED-panel serial number.
